.22 and .47 are standard values that will work fine and the rest are
standard values in those yellow 400 and 630V film caps.
Search Fleabay for surplus dealers and those values are usually pretty cheap
since there are little requirements. If that fails try Mouser.

>I am still working on my SB-610 and it brought to mind that Heath used a
>ton of those black beauty caps
> and it seems that almost all of them are 400VDC or 600VDC and mostly .1,
> .15, .5 1mfd or .25mfd so there
> are a bunch that you guys have replaced.
>
> What value do you usually replace them with? Most of the time I have gone
> up in value but I suspect that
> going down on some could be ok since these are rarely if ever used in
> freq. determining circuits.
